Biodegradable superabsorbent materials are highly absorbent polymers that can retain large amounts of water or other liquids relative to their own weight. They are designed to provide efficient and effective absorption and retention properties while also being environmentally friendly.

One of the key drivers for the growth of the biodegradable superabsorbent materials market is the rising awareness and concern about the environmental impact of conventional superabsorbent materials, which are primarily derived from non-renewable sources. These conventional materials have limited biodegradability and can contribute to long-lasting environmental pollution. In contrast, biodegradable superabsorbent materials are derived from renewable sources, such as natural polymers or bio-based synthetic polymers, and can undergo degradation into environmentally benign products.

The demand for biodegradable superabsorbent materials is being driven by various industries, including agriculture, hygiene products, medical applications, and packaging. In the agriculture sector, these materials are used in soil conditioning, irrigation, and as water retention agents to enhance crop productivity and reduce water consumption. In the hygiene products industry, biodegradable superabsorbent materials are utilized in diapers, adult incontinence products, and feminine hygiene products, offering enhanced absorbency and improved biodegradability compared to traditional superabsorbent materials.

The medical sector is also a significant consumer of biodegradable superabsorbent materials. These materials are used in wound dressings, surgical sponges, and other medical products to effectively manage wound exudate and promote faster healing. Biodegradable superabsorbent materials offer advantages such as reduced risk of infection, enhanced patient comfort, and easier disposal.

The packaging industry is another key sector driving the demand for biodegradable superabsorbent materials. These materials are used in packaging applications to absorb and retain moisture, extend the shelf life of perishable products, and prevent spoilage. Biodegradable superabsorbent materials offer an environmentally friendly alternative to traditional packaging materials that are non-biodegradable and contribute to plastic waste accumulation.

The biodegradable superabsorbent materials market is also supported by favorable government regulations and initiatives promoting sustainable practices and the use of eco-friendly materials. Many countries are implementing regulations and standards to reduce the environmental impact of products and encourage the adoption of biodegradable alternatives. This regulatory landscape creates opportunities for manufacturers to develop innovative biodegradable superabsorbent materials that comply with sustainability requirements.

However, the biodegradable superabsorbent materials market still faces challenges that need to be addressed. One of the key challenges is the cost of production, as biodegradable materials can be more expensive compared to conventional materials. Additionally, there is a need for further research and development to enhance the performance and properties of biodegradable superabsorbent materials, such as their absorbency, biodegradation rate, and mechanical strength.
